 Members of the Westboro Baptist Church (3701 Southwest 12th Street, Topeka, KS 66604, 785-273-0325, http://www.godhatesfags.com/) and their "pastor", Fred Phelps, are some of the most disgusting people it has ever been my misfortune to hear about.
This den of vipers are the "Christians" responsible for protesting outside military funerals claiming that every dead soldier is God's punishment for America tolerating homosexuals. They hide behind the First Amendment while carrying signs with the slogans, "Thank God For Dead Soldiers", "God Hates Your Tears", "Thank God For 9/11", and "Thank God For IED's".
